By: Van de Putte S.B. No. 983
(In the Senate - Filed March 4, 2005; March 14, 2005, read
first time and referred to Committee on Health and Human Services;
April 6, 2005, reported adversely, with favorable Committee
Substitute by the following vote: Yeas 9, Nays 0; April 6, 2005,
sent to printer.)
COMMITTEE SUBSTITUTE FOR S.B. No. 983 By: Zaffirini
A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
AN ACT
relating to hospice services under the state child health plan.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
SECTION 1. Section 62.151, Health and Safety Code, is
amended by adding Subsection (g) to read as follows:
(g) The child health plan must provide hospice services as a
covered benefit.
SECTION 2. If before implementing any provision of this Act
the Health and Human Services Commission or another state agency
determines that a waiver or authorization from a federal agency is
necessary for implementation of that provision, the agency affected
by the provision shall request the waiver or authorization and may
delay implementing that provision until the waiver or authorization
is granted.
SECTION 3. This Act takes effect September 1, 2005.
